Jesse Houston
Pitcher · Career Stats, Bio & Records
Jesse Houston was a pitcher who played in Major League Baseball for the Cincinnati Tigers, the Chicago American Giants, and the Homestead Grays. Across 48 career appearances, he went 20-12 with a 3.26 ERA and 165 strikeouts. His totals include Negro Leagues seasons, which MLB recognized as major league in 2020.
